Summary
view,comment, andcloserepository context in the release contract testReproduction
Adding
builtto monitor-created issue #3 launched run 30727885122. The job failed before validating the marker becausegh issue viewreportedfatal: not a git repository; the job has no checkout from whichghcan infer a repository.Solution
Use
--repo "$GITHUB_REPOSITORY"for issue reads, comments, and closes in the skip, built, accepted, approval, and local handoff jobs. This keeps these jobs checkout-free and least-privilege while making repository selection deterministic.Validation
scripts/test-private-ca-release-contract.shshellcheck scripts/test-private-ca-release-contract.sh scripts/normalize-private-ca-desktop-tag.shgit diff --checkAfter merge, removing/re-adding the existing
builtlabel on issue #3 will retry only the already-accepted v0.5.2 lifecycle record; it will not build or install v0.5.3.
